"All of the sounds heard on this recording are from custom made machine/robot instruments. None of the sounds on this recording come from store bought instruments, samples, albums nor field recordings. The sounds come from sound machines I made. Let’s just call me a purist.

I often felt like I was coaxing my motorcycle to talk. Or training a puppy.
This work can be utilized in many ways…. for instance put it on and do your housework. Vacuuming the floor or grinding coffee allows you to perform and collaborate with me!

These are compositions not so much songs. They are arranged sounds."
-- Kal Spelletich, 2020
